About
Description
Economics Arkansas is a well-established brand that has been promoting economic literacy in Arkansas since its founding in 1962. As a private, non-profit, non-partisan educational organization, Economics Arkansas aims to equip K-12 teachers with the knowledge and tools to incorporate principles of economics and personal finance into their classroom curriculum. Through their comprehensive training programs and resources, Economics Arkansas ensures that teachers are equipped to provide students with real-life economic education.
They believe that by investing in teacher training, they can have a multiplier effect on student learning, impacting countless children each school year. Economics Arkansas collaborates with affiliated councils and six university-based Centers for Economic Education in Arkansas to expand their reach and provide training, materials, and curriculum to schools across the state. They also extend their resources through the Polly M.
Jackson Master Economics Teachers program. With a rich history of fundraising, Economics Arkansas has been able to support teachers and students by providing scholarships for workshops and training sessions. Their dedication to economic literacy has made a lasting impact on education in Arkansas for over 60 years
